- The distance between Santuck, Sc, Usa and Bondoukou, Ivory Coast is approximately 8,515 km or 5,292 mi.
- To reach Santuck, Sc in this distance one would set out from Bondoukou bearing 304.2°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Santuck, Sc bearing 269.5° or W .
- Santuck, Sc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Bondoukou has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Santuck, Sc is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Bondoukou is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 9.6 °C (17.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.7 °C (30.1°F) more in Santuck, Sc.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 114.9 mm (4.5 in) more which is equivalent to 114.9 l/m² (2.82 US gal/ft²) or 1,149,000 l/ha (122,836 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 19° lower in Santuck, Sc than in Bondoukou.
